Default What holsters do you use?

Just wondering what types, brands, models,ect. of holsters you guys and girls are using. I personally use a Blackhawk SERPA and a Kramer belt scabbard for my Glock and a Kramer belt scabbard for my Kimber. I use a Gould & Goodrich 1.5 belt and a Blackhawk 1.25 CQC belt also. All the equpment I've been using has been great (the Glock Kramer is 11 years old).

Me too...the 1st gen one-piece kind.

IWB, long stretch of time: CTAC. Comfortable, but takes some time to wrestle into place.

IWB, quick trip to store: Sidearmor 1st gen IWB....quick and easy.

Like a moth to flame, I keep coming back and trying leather/horsehide holsters, but they always rub audibly for me. As we speak, I have 2 more attempts on order....

I tried OWB, but I'm such a small guy that even a G19 in an OWB looks like I have a tumor on my side. I've tried Blade-Tech and Comp-Tacs OWB, nothing seems to work for me but IWB.


"CTAC. Comfortable, but takes some time to wrestle into place."

That's why I sold my CTAC

I LOVE my IWB Comp-Tac Gurkha because the loation of the clips go perfectly with the location of the belt loops on my Woolrich Elite pants. All I have to do it put the holster on my belt, then slide it back until it stops. It's in the same place every time.
